Ground Calcium Carbonate (GCC) is one of the most versatile and widely used functional fillers and pigments globally, integral to industries such as plastics, paper, paints, coatings, adhesives, and pharmaceuticals. Its value is derived from properties like brightness, purity, and precisely controlled particle size.

The production of premium GCC demands more than simple size reduction; it requires the ability to produce a narrow particle size distribution (PSD), preserve whiteness, and achieve high top-cut specifications (e.g., d98 < 10µm for fine papers).

The LIMING vertical mill meets these demands through its advanced grinding and classification system. The material is ground by the bed-compression method between rollers and a table, a process that generates less heat and mechanical shear compared to traditional ball mills. This is crucial for preventing the degradation of organic coatings often applied to GCC and for maintaining the mineral's natural brightness.
